Holdcroft Motor Group has bought ALM Garages’ Hyundai business in Macclesfield for an undisclosed sum.
This is Holdcroft’s fifth Hyundai business. It already runs the franchise in Crewe, Hanley, Stafford and Ellesmere Port.
Its most recent acquisition was in July last year when it bought a Hyundai business in Stafford.
Holdcroft is rated 45 in the motor Motor Trader Top 200 with annual turnover of £293.8m
Darren Holdcroft, managing director at Holdcroft Motor Group, said: “Macclesfield is a region where we have wanted to operate for some time and we are delighted to have purchased the ALM business.
“We very much look forward to welcoming some new colleagues into the group. Macclesfield is a great market and I feel that ALM will complement our growing portfolio.”
David Kendrick, partner at UHY Hacker Young, which advised the shareholders of ALM Garages with the sale said:
“ALM Garages have represented a number of brands in Macclesfield over the years and have a very strong name in the area.
“Becoming part of a larger group such as Holdcroft will no doubt bring further opportunities for the business to flourish.”
